About the host
Hosted by Robyn Ogden
Labor of Love
My name is Robyn Ogden. My husband Dan and I have owned property on Lake Mason for the past 17 years. We have 3 kids that have grown up on Lake Mason and spending wonderful family time there, fishing, boating, floating, sitting by the fire pit, signing karaoke, cooking great food, playing hockey on our ice rink in the winter or just hanging out watching a movie on cold or rainy days.
Our current place on the lake we call “The Barnhouse” It has been a labor of love over the past 14 years or so. We purchased the lot because of the lake's great sandy bottom area and large level lot. When looking at what we wanted to build on the lot, we just couldn’t find what we really wanted. To be honest, I don’t know that we really knew what we wanted. One day we were inside our barn at our home 50 miles from the lake. We started looking around and seeing the beauty of the barn that was constructed with rough sawn and hand crafted timbers and wooden pegs in the early 1890’s. We started thinking how amazing it would be if we made that into our lake house. Well the journey began shortly thereafter…
Piece by piece, the barn was disassembled and numbered, then sandblasted, sorted and prepared for transport. With very limited resources we began the process one little bit at a time. Foundation one year, timber frame the next year and so on…we moved at a snail’s pace but each and every detail was done to perfection. We designed every aspect of the house to accommodate our family and have plenty of space for entertaining guests. We love to share our space with others looking to relax and enjoy lake living as much as we do.
